How many rounds of golf did Obama play?

President Obama played his first round of golf as President on 26 April 2009, more than three months after he took office. President Obama then played more than 300 rounds of golf ( 306 according to Golf Digest; 333 according to CBS News) during his eight years in office. How many golf trips did Trump make to Bedminster?

Trump has played golf during 24 of 96 trips to Bedminster since the beginning of his presidency, according to a table maintained by TrumpGolfCount.com. But Kessler questioned the practice of attributing travel costs for the president and his support staff exclusively to golf.

How much did Trump spend on Mar-a-Lago?

Using the same data for a February 2019 report, the Washington Post estimated Trump's trips to Mar-a-Lago alone cost the U.S. taxpayer approximately $64 million during his first two years in office. Why was the PGA Grand Slam cancelled?

In 2015, they canceled the PGA Grand Slam at the Trump National Los Angeles Golf Club after Trump made disparaging remarks about Mexican immigrants when he was running for president. The PGA of America awarded that tournament to the Trump Organization’s New Jersey golf course back in 2014.

Is the PGA taking the PGA Championship away from Trump?

What's True . The PGA of America voted to take the PGA Championship event away from Trump’s New Jersey golf course in 2022. As of this writing, the PGA website shows no future events being held at a Trump-owned golf course through 2034. What's False.

Is the PGA golf course in New Jersey a lifetime ban?

The PGA has not announced any lifetime ban for Trump golf courses, but they have decided not to hold the 2022 PGA Championship at the Trump-owned golf course in New Jersey. As such, we rate this claim a “Mixture.”.

Claim

President Donald Trump, in applying for permission to build a wall at his golf course in Ireland, warned against the threat of coastal erosion caused by global warming.

Rating

As part of a May 2016 planning application in County Clare, Ireland, a local firm -- acting of behalf of Trump's company TIGL -- submitted a report that repeatedly referred to global warming and climate change as real phenomena posing specific risks (rising sea levels and extreme storms) to the erosion of sand dunes at the Doonbeg golf course.
